It displays other gif files. 
but not the ones I store in dia .

Renaming a .png into a .gif does not really turn the image into a gif. If
you really want to make a .gif with dia, despite the legal and ethical
problems with that kind of undertaking, export the diagram into a PNG file,
named with a .png extension, and THEN, using ANOTHER PROGRAM (not Windows
Explorer...), convert that PNG file into a GIF (or into a PCX or a TGA, or

